Some of you might know that there was a fabulous sporting event in Denver this weekend…No, I don’t mean the Colorado Rockies wuppin’ of the Arizona Diamondbacks.  I’m talking about the International Gay Rodeo Association 2007 Finals which were held at the National Western Stock Show Events Center from Friday to Sunday!

 

The gay Rodeo, which started in 1976 in Reno Nevada, has been one of the premier entertainment events for the gay community. Since its inception, it has branched out into many other local organizations and cities around the United States and Canada which have come together to form the International Gay Rodeo Association.

 

In 1987, the IGRA held the first finals event where the top 20 qualifiers from local and regional competitions could compete for top honors in classic rodeo competitions such as bull & bronco riding, barrel racing and other traditional rodeo events as well as some hilarious "camp" events designed specifically for the Gay Rodeo. .
